Hobart Tower Motel is a 3-star motel in Hobart, Tasmania, Australia. Located at 300 Park Street, it sits about 1.3mi from Hobart's city center. The property has earned 1,915 reviews from guests, with rates starting from $53 per night.
Featured amenities include free on-site parking, free Wi-Fi, room service, air conditioning, a private entrance, non-smoking rooms, kitchenware, and free toiletries.
A budget-friendly option for travelers seeking simple comfort in Hobart, this motel pairs practical value with handy conveniences for an easy, relaxed stay.

Payment options include cash as well as Mastercard, Visa, Eftpos, and UnionPay, making transactions easy for travelers arriving from near or far.
A variety of room types cater to different groups, from compact options to larger family setups. For example, the Family room spans 398 sqft and accommodates up to 8 adults and 4 children with 3 Twin beds and 1 Double bed; the Standard Queen Room (248 sqft) features a Queen bed and accommodates up to 4 adults and 3 children; the Standard Room (215 sqft) offers 1 Twin and 1 Double bed for up to 4 adults and 3 children. Budget, Economy, and other Standard configurations round out the selection for an easy, no-fuss stay.

The instructions for access to our room after hours were very clear. The room was exceptionally clean, but since our stay was the beginning of winter, we would have appreciated an electric blanket on the bed. The air conditioner warmed the room quickly though. The towels were large, soft and changed daily. Breakfast is not offered, but the room is equipped with a kettle, toaster, microwave and fridge. Our room had a view through a stain-glassed window to Mt Wellington (kunanyi). Access to the top of the tower was fun for sensing the history of the reception area and providing a vista over Hobart city, and the Derwent River.
Our stay would have been perfect if there was an electric blanket on the bed.
